Comprehending Types of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ement process, it is necessary to comprehend the different car key types available:
Car Key TypeDescriptionReplacement ComplexityCost RangeTraditional KeyBasic, metal keys without electronic functions.Low₤ 5 - ₤ 30Transponder KeyKeys with embedded chips that interact with the vehicle.Moderate₤ 50 - ₤ 150Key Fob/ Smart KeyAdvanced keys that enable keyless entry and start features, frequently geared up with remotes.High₤ 150 - ₤ 500Valet KeyA simplified variation of a key that allows restricted access to the vehicle.Moderate₤ 50 - ₤ 100Factors to Consider When Replacing Lost Car Keys
When confronted with the regrettable circumstance of losing car keys, a number of factors will affect the replacement procedure:
Type of Key: The more advanced the key (such as fobs or transponder keys), the more complicated and pricey the replacement may be.
Vehicle Make and Model: Replacement expenses and approaches can vary considerably based on the car's brand name, model, and year.
Availability of Spare Keys: If a spare key exists, duplication can be a more simple and less costly option.
Area of Replacement: Deciding whether to approach a dealer, locksmith professional, or auto store can impact both expense and time.
Cost: The range of expenses for key replacement can be significant, with some methods proving to be more affordable than others.
Techniques for Replacing Lost Car Keys
There are several methods one can pursue in replacing lost car keys, from DIY options to professional services.
1. Expert Locksmith Services
An expert locksmith can supply a fast and often more economical service for changing lost keys. They generally offer the following services:
Key Duplication: If a spare key is available, a locksmith can quickly reproduce it.Reprogramming: For keys that have transponder functions, locksmith professionals can typically reprogram existing keys and fobs.Cutting New Keys: A locksmith can produce a brand-new key from the vehicle's lock, admitted is readily available.2. Car Dealerships
Going to a car dealership is another typical option for key replacement, especially for advanced keys.
Factory Replacement: Dealerships have access to manufacturer-specific key codes, enabling them to make a specific reproduction.More Expensive: This method is normally the most pricey however may be needed for particular makes or designs.3. DIY Solutions
For individuals comfortable handling a challenge, some DIY techniques might work depending on the situation.
Key Programming Kits: Some online resources and kits allow owners to program spare keys themselves, especially for particular models.Short-lived Solutions: In emergencies, producing makeshift keys or hot-wiring may work for older designs however is typically not advised due to legality and damage threats.4. Insurance coverage Options
Some auto insurance plan cover key replacement or loss. For that reason, reviewing one's policy might expose if financial support is available for this inconvenience.
5. Mobile Key Replacement Services
With the development of innovation, mobile locksmith services can concern your place to offer key replacement. They may provide:
Convenience: No need to tow the vehicle or leave home.Quick Service: Many can cut and set new keys on-site.Preventive Measures to Avoid Lost Car Keys

Frequently Asked Questions about Lost Car Keys Replacement1. Just how much does it typically cost to replace lost car keys?
The cost of changing lost car keys can differ extensively based upon the type of key and where you have it replaced. Basic keys can vary from ₤ 5 to ₤ 30, while clever keys can cost upwards of ₤ 150 to ₤ 500.
2. Can I replace my lost car key without a spare?
Yes, you can replace a lost car key without a spare. An expert locksmith professional or car dealership can create a brand-new key by accessing your vehicle's lock or utilizing the vehicle identification number (VIN).
3. How long does it require to replace lost car keys?
Replacement times can differ by method. A locksmith might require simply 15-- 30 minutes, while dealerships might take longer, specifically if they need to order specific keys.
4. Exist any legal factors to consider if I lost my car keys?
No particular legal issues develop from losing keys. Nevertheless, if someone discovers your lost keys, they might potentially access your car, calling for careful practices relating to individual security.
5. What if my keys are stolen?
If your keys are taken, it's important to take instant action. Besides replacing your keys, consider altering your locks or utilizing a locksmith professional to reprogram your transponder keys to avoid unapproved access.
